Belrose · Statistical Area 2 (SA2)
Where people and their families come from — the ancestries they identify with and where they were born.
Cultural backgrounds in Belrose have remained steady over the last decade, with a strong continuing link to British and Irish roots. Nearly 40% of residents claim English ancestry, making it the most common heritage in the area.
The ancestries people most identify with.
English ancestry is the most common at 39.9%, followed by Australian at 33.5%. Irish and Scottish roots are also prominent, making up 11.2% and 9.6% of the population respectively.
Australia and the largest overseas communities.
People born overseas make up 28.6% of the population, which is higher than most similar areas. This figure is about the same as the state and national rates, with England being the most common overseas birthplace at 7%.
